27 March: MediaBistro: CNN, Ratings
March & Q1 2012: CNN Loses Half its Audience
CNN bore the brunt of the downward trend the news networks experienced this month and for much of the first quarter, when compared to the busy first few months of 2011. For the month of March, CNN was down -50% in total viewers and down -60% in A25-54 viewers (Total Day)…
All the cable news networks were down compared to the first quarter a year ago …
CNN reached an average monthly cumulative audience of 91 million viewers during the first quarter 2012, FNC followed with 77 million and MSNBC had 74 million.
